Ronald L. Reyes
About
Ronald L. Reyes has authored 10 papers that have received a total of 200 indexed citations.
This includes 5 papers in Education, 2 papers in Organic Chemistry and 2 papers in Inorganic Chemistry. The topics of these papers are Science Education and Pedagogy (4 papers), Asymmetric Hydrogenation and Catalysis (2 papers) and Digital Storytelling and Education (2 papers). Ronald L. Reyes is often cited by papers focused on Science Education and Pedagogy (4 papers), Asymmetric Hydrogenation and Catalysis (2 papers) and Digital Storytelling and Education (2 papers) and collaborates with scholars based in Philippines and Japan. Ronald L. Reyes's co-authors include Masaya Sawamura, Tomohiro Iwai, Kenji Monde, Tohru Taniguchi and Tomoya Harada and has published in prestigious journals such as Chemical Reviews, Chemistry Letters and Journal of Chemical Education.
